Could someone tell me the width in a 16' Scamp? I'm hoping to find a side-bath layout (Layout #4, I believe), and would like to know how wide the aisle is...
Of course the width is less where the bathroom is (layout #4), because the bathroom sticks out further from the side wall than the counter next to it. However since it is accross from the door, I think that narrowing is not a issue. I'm suprised no one has reported that measurement for you yet but perhaps there are not many layout fours around. I can get the width for you but not until about October first, after I get my Scamp.
BTW, some people object to the bath next to the sofa as it creates a dead space where the sofa is next to the bathroom.. that area is not as usable. I hope to figure out a way to store bed clothes or something in this area.
